In the fast-paced world of contracting and small business management, proper invoicing is one of the most important—yet often overlooked—aspects of running a successful operation. Whether you’re a general contractor, freelancer, or small business owner, invoicing ensures you get paid on time, maintain professional standards, and keep accurate financial records for tax compliance.

Thankfully, there are plenty of solutions available that simplify invoicing, including professionally designed free invoice templates that allow contractors and business owners to generate polished invoices without starting from scratch. With the right invoice template, you can focus less on paperwork and more on growing your business.

What Makes a Solid Invoice Template?

Before diving into specific templates, it’s important to understand what elements make an invoice template truly useful for contractors and small business owners:

  • Business and Client Details: Full names, addresses, and contact info for both the service provider and customer.

  • Invoice Number: A unique identifier for bookkeeping and tax purposes.

  • Project or Service Description: Clear breakdowns of services performed, materials used, hours worked, or other charges.

  • Line Items and Rates: Transparent calculation of quantity, rate, and totals for each service or item billed.

  • Tax Calculations: Accurate sales tax, GST, VAT, or HST figures as applicable to your jurisdiction.

  • Payment Terms: Including due dates, late payment penalties, and accepted payment methods.

  • Notes Section: For special instructions, disclaimers, or warranty information.

  • Digital Payment Links: Optional fields for electronic payment systems like PayPal, Stripe, or ACH transfers.

A well-designed invoice template simplifies bookkeeping, reduces errors, and reinforces your business’s professionalism.

Recommended Free Invoice Templates for Contractors & Small Businesses

While paid invoicing platforms offer extensive features, many free templates offer more than enough functionality for small businesses. Here are some of the best:

1. InvoiceFly’s Free Templates

InvoiceFly offers a comprehensive library of free invoice templates tailored for contractors, freelancers, and small businesses. Their templates are fully editable, visually appealing, and include:

  • Multiple industry-specific layouts.

  • Pre-formatted tax and discount calculations.

  • Fields for digital payments and notes.

  • Easy export options to PDF or print.

Whether you’re billing for construction projects, consulting, or services, InvoiceFly’s templates provide the flexibility you need to get paid quickly and maintain a professional image.

2. Microsoft Office Templates

Microsoft Word and Excel offer free downloadable invoice templates for contractors through their built-in template libraries. These are excellent for users who prefer working with familiar office software and include formulas to automatically calculate subtotals, taxes, and totals.

3. Adobe Express Contractor Templates

Adobe Express (formerly Adobe Spark) provides a variety of visually attractive invoice templates that can be customized online for free. Contractors and small business owners can easily brand their invoices with logos, fonts, and color schemes.

4. Smartsheet Construction Templates

Smartsheet offers free downloadable contractor invoicing templates, particularly suited for construction companies managing large jobs with detailed materials and labor breakdowns. Their templates include fields for job numbers, site locations, subcontractor details, and more.

5. Bookipi Small Business Templates

Bookipi offers simple, modern invoice templates that are highly adaptable to various industries. The cloud-based platform also allows users to store and track invoices, adding lightweight CRM-like functionality.

Best Practices for Contractor Invoicing

Even with great templates, invoicing requires consistent habits to ensure accuracy, compliance, and timely payments:

  • Invoice Promptly: Send invoices as soon as work is completed.

  • Clearly State Payment Terms: Include due dates and penalties for late payments.

  • Use Sequential Invoice Numbers: Maintain easy-to-track records.

  • Break Down Charges: Include itemized lists of labor, materials, and additional costs.

  • Maintain Backup Documentation: Save receipts, contracts, and signed approvals.

According to the IRS Guide for Small Business Recordkeeping, clear and consistent invoicing practices help support tax deductions and prepare businesses for audits or financial reviews.

Digital Invoicing Tools & Automation

While free templates are a great starting point, many contractors eventually benefit from digital invoicing software that offers:

  • Automated Invoice Generation: Populate recurring fields automatically.

  • Payment Reminders: Automatically notify clients about upcoming due dates.

  • Recurring Billing: Ideal for service retainers or subscription-based models.

  • Tax Calculation Tools: Automatically update regional tax rates.

  • Client Portals: Allow customers to view and pay invoices online.

Some popular platforms include:

  • InvoiceFly

  • FreshBooks

  • Zoho Invoice

  • QuickBooks Online

Automated invoicing reduces manual data entry, improves cash flow, and provides real-time tracking of outstanding payments.

Customization Tips for Small Businesses

A customized invoice reinforces your brand identity while making payment processing smoother. Consider:

  • Logo and Color Scheme: Use consistent business branding.

  • Accepted Payment Methods: List multiple payment options.

  • Digital Signatures: Include areas for client authorization if needed.

  • Foreign Currency Options: For businesses working with international clients.

  • Tax Identification Numbers: Display your business tax ID or VAT number.

Customization helps present a professional appearance and minimizes client confusion during payment processing.

Ensuring Professionalism & Faster Payments

Invoicing is more than paperwork—it’s part of your client relationship management. Here’s how to encourage timely payments:

  • Clear Payment Policies: Set expectations upfront with clients.

  • Shorter Payment Terms: Net 15 or net 30 terms encourage prompt payment.

  • Late Fee Disclosures: List penalties for overdue payments.

  • Convenient Payment Options: Offer credit cards, bank transfers, and online wallets.

  • Prompt Delivery: Send invoices immediately upon job completion.

Troubleshooting Common Invoice Problems

Even the best systems may encounter occasional challenges. Common issues include:

  • Duplicate Invoices: Ensure numbering systems avoid repetition.

  • Tax Miscalculations: Verify rates and tax applicability for each jurisdiction.

  • Missing Client Details: Incomplete addresses or contact information can delay payments.

  • Disputed Charges: Keep thorough records to resolve client disputes.

By addressing these common issues proactively, businesses can reduce payment delays and build stronger client relationships.

Tax Compliance Considerations

Image from Unsplash

Contractors and small business owners must keep meticulous records for income reporting, deductions, and audits. Invoicing templates support this effort by providing standardized documentation.

For contractors operating as sole proprietors, LLCs, or corporations, tax authorities such as the Canada Revenue Agency (CRA) or the U.S. Internal Revenue Service (IRS) may request invoice records during audits.

According to the IRS, businesses should retain financial records, including invoices, for at least three years to comply with federal regulations.

Future Trends in Contractor Invoicing

Technology continues to evolve the invoicing process. Contractors and small businesses should watch for:

  • AI-Powered Invoice Generators: Automatically draft invoices based on time tracking, expenses, and previous templates.

  • Blockchain-Based Invoicing: Secure, tamper-proof invoice verification.

  • Instant Cross-Border Payments: Seamless global currency transactions.

  • Integration with Project Management Tools: Sync invoicing with job tracking software.

  • Predictive Cash Flow Forecasting: Using AI to estimate future receivables based on past client behavior.

By staying informed about these emerging trends, businesses can maintain a competitive edge while improving cash flow management.

A well-structured invoicing system can significantly improve cash flow, enhance professionalism, and simplify tax compliance for contractors and small businesses. Whether you’re just starting or managing multiple projects, using professionally designed invoice templates allows you to focus on growing your business while staying financially organized.

Free invoice templates like those offered by InvoiceFly provide an excellent starting point for anyone who wants simplicity, customization, and efficiency without the cost of complex accounting software. For businesses looking to scale, pairing these templates with automation tools can further streamline invoicing, reduce errors, and accelerate payments.

Ultimately, the best invoicing system is one that fits your business’s specific needs, keeps you compliant, and helps you get paid on time—allowing you to spend more time doing what you do best.